What is ASTM D5032?

ASTM D5032, Standard Practice for Maintaining Constant Relative Humidity by Means of Aqueous Glycerin Solutions, describes a practical approach for achieving stable relative humidity using glycerin-water mixtures. The standard is relevant when a controlled humidity environment is needed for materials conditioning, test preparation, or other technical procedures. As an ASTM standard, it provides a common reference for consistent practice, helping users follow a recognized method rather than relying on informal humidity control.

Where is ASTM D5032 used?

This standard is commonly used in laboratory and test-environment settings where relative humidity must be held at a fairly constant level. It may support conditioning chambers, sealed containers, or other controlled spaces that rely on aqueous glycerin solutions to regulate moisture conditions. ASTM D5032 is especially relevant when test samples, materials, or components need a stable atmosphere before evaluation, helping users maintain repeatable environmental conditions across routine workflows.
